ATG Acquires Associated Medical Specialties’ Rehab Segment

July 17, 2012 by Laurie Watanabe

ATG Rehab has acquired the complex rehab technology segment of Associated Medical Specialties, a supplier business based in Philadelphia.

A news announcement on the new business deal said ATG and Associated Medical “will co-market their respective services to customers, payors and medical facilities throughout the region. ATG will focus on complex rehab, and Associated will focus on durable medical equipment and all other non-rehab services it currently provides.”

ATG says it will process Associated Medical’s complex rehab orders in ATG’s Hatsfield, Pa., office. “The company’s ATPs and support team will ensure a smooth transition from current status to delivery,” the news announcement said. “ATG will contact clients, clinicians and the appropriate facilities regarding the status and process for each order.”

Neill Rowland, ATG’s mid-Atlantic director of sales & marketing, said of the transition, “ATG Rehab will work diligently to transition all current orders as efficiently as possible. ATG works with the same suppliers as Associated, so order placements and shipments will be seamless for our customers.”

ATG Rehab has more than 50 locations in 30 states.
